Alexander Zverev secured a compelling victory against Flavio Cobolli in a dramatic midnight session, showcasing his prowess on the court. This victory at the ATP Master Series in Paris not only elevated Zverev in the rankings but also stirred interest within sports investment circles, highlighting potential shifts in market dynamics.
Zverev's Triumph in Paris
In a match that kept fans on the edge of their seats, Zverev overpowered Cobolli with a final score of 6-3, 7-5. The match, played at the Accor Arena, attracted significant viewership, boosting the visibility of the tournament. Zverev's performance further cements his status as a top contender in the tennis world, with implications for sponsorship and brand endorsements.
Following his victory, Zverev's marketability is expected to increase, potentially attracting new sponsorship deals. The tennis star has already been associated with brands like Adidas and Head, and his recent success could lead to renewed contract terms or additional partnerships.
